NBA Swag of the Season

Sonam Kapoor Ahuja and Anand Ahuja announce their Favorites

  The brain behind apparel brand Bhane and VegNonVeg Anand Ahuja and Bollywood Actor, fashionista Sonam Kapoor got together to talk NBA and to talk the NBA Swag.The couple dissect the style quotient and fashion of NBA Players and ultimately announce their personal favorite on NBA SWAG of The Season.

 From Karl Anthony’s simple and elevated look to Chris Paul’s seasoned choice of color to Carmelo Anthony’s obsession with listening to music and having coffee (just like Sonam), it wasn’t an easy pick. Add to that the unconventional look of D’Angelo Russel and the striking handsomeness of Jimmy Butler really made it all the more difficult.

While James Harden’s iconic beard and Damian Lillard’s personal style of incorporating local art in his attire really stands out with Sonam and Anand, there is no one except for Russell Westbrook who can really carry off leather pants and silver jacket!

 Last but not the least; they compared Shai Gilgeous-Alexander’s unique young style and confidence to Harshvardhan Kapoor, which really ended up as the winner!

 Sonam also highlights how athletes are cultural icons expressing themselves through fashion as it is after all a reflection of their soul.
